Description
The AP4310E is a monolithic IC specifically designed to regulate the output current and voltage levels of switching battery chargers and power supplies
The device contains two Op Amps and a 2.5V precision shunt voltage reference. Op Amp 1 is designed for voltage control with its noninverting input internally connected to the output of the shuntregulator. Op Amp 2 is for current control with both inputs uncommitted. The IC offers the power converter designer a controlsolution that features increased precision with a corresponding reduction in system complexity and cost. AP4310E has more stringent reference voltage tolerance and offset.
The AP4310E is available in standard package of SO-8.

Features
OP Amp
Input Offset Voltage: 0.5mV
Supply Current: 75A per OP Amp at 5.0V Supply Voltage
Unity Gain Bandwidth:1MHz
Output Voltage Swing: 0 to VCC-1.5V
Power Supply Range: 3 to 36V Voltage Reference
Fixed Output Voltage Reference: 2.5V
Reference Voltage Tolerance: ±0.4%
Sink Current Capability: 0.05 to 80mA
Typical Output Impedance: 0.2Ω
